Two Additional Suspects Identified

November 2nd, 2011 by WCBC Radio

The Maryland State Police Cumberland Barrack and the Allegany County Combined Criminal Investigation Unit (C3I) are searching for two (2) suspects wanted in connection with the armed robbery that occurred on October 27, 2011 at Steve’s Pharmacy, Cresaptown, Maryland.   Working jointly with the Allegany County Sheriff’s Department, Mineral County Sheriff’s Department and Keyser City Police Department, investigators have been able to identify these suspects as being responsible for the armed robbery at the pharmacy in Cresaptown and the two recent pharmacy robberies that occurred in Mineral County, West Virginia.  Warrants have been obtained for the arrest of the following two suspects: Dulin Mayhew, 20 years of age, white/male, height: 5’-07” weight:  125 pounds, brown eyes – brown hair and Stephen Mayhew, 25 years of age, white/male, height:  5’-10” 170 pounds, hazel eyes – brown hair.

Dulin and Stephen Mayhew were last known to be in the Keyser, West Virginia area on Sunday, October 31, 2011 and their current whereabouts are unknown.  They could possibly be operating a 2000 Buick Century displaying West Virginia registration:  DMA-724.

Anyone with information on the whereabouts of Dulin and Stephen Mayhew are urged to contact their local police department.
